What Is an Online Crypto Casino?
An online crypto casino is a gambling website that accepts cryptocurrency-- most commonly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and stablecoins such as GBPC-- as the primary technique of deposits, withdrawals, and wagering. Unlike conventional online casinos that count on fiat currencies and third‑party payment processors, crypto casinos take advantage of blockchain's decentralized journal to tape-record transactions. This setup can provide increased openness, faster payments, and lower costs.
How Crypto Casinos Work
Wallet Creation-- Players create a cryptocurrency wallet (either on the platform or through an external service) to keep their digital funds. Deposit-- Using a QR code or copy‑paste address, the gamer transfers crypto from their personal wallet to the casino's wallet. The deposit is verified on the blockchain, generally within minutes. Betting-- The transferred balance is transformed (internally) to a casino‑specific "credits" or kept in the initial crypto, depending on the platform's style. Players then put bets on video games such as slots, poker, blackjack, or live dealership tables. Result Verification-- Many crypto gambling establishments utilize "provably reasonable" algorithms, enabling gamers to verify the fairness of each video game outcome by comparing cryptographic hashes. Withdrawal-- When a gamer demands a payout, the casino sends the cryptocurrency directly to the player's wallet. The legal status of online crypto casinos differs around the world. Some countries, such as the United Kingdom and Malta, have developed clear licensing frameworks that include cryptocurrency operators. Others, including lots of U.S. states, deal with crypto gambling likewise to fiat betting, requiring operators to get a license while sticking to stringent consumer‑protection guidelines. Still, a variety of countries impose straight-out bans or uncertain regulations, leaving players to browse gray areas.
From a security viewpoint, respectable crypto casinos employ a mix of hot wallets (linked to the web for daily transactions) and cold wallets (offline storage) to protect player funds. Two‑factor authentication (2FA), SSL file encryption, and routine third‑party security audits are extra markers of a credible platform.

2. How do I guarantee a casino is provably fair?
Many reliable crypto casinos publish a "provably reasonable" guide that explains the cryptographic approach used to produce game outcomes. Gamers can validate each round by comparing the offered hash with the server seed.
